04.25.2010. The Coen Brothers are remaking True Grit, the 1969 John Wayne-Glen Campbell Western. The remake was partly filmed in Granger, Texas, a small town northeast of Austin. The main downtown street in Granger was turned into a movie set to stand in for Fort Smith, Arkansas. Before the filming started, the "set" was open to anyone who wanted to wander around. by Lamar Abrams.
Published by AdHouse Books
Remake is 144 pages of silly action and crazy nonsence. Right now the story focuses on max guy, a robot boy who can't seem to stay out of trouble. He's got this gun called the *MAX BLASTER* that turns things into stuff.
